On May 19, Arkport voters approved a $15.4 million proposed budget for the 2026-27 school year by a vote of 141 (yes) to 74 (no), a 65.6% approval. The budget carries a $342,090.00 decrease in spending over the current year’s budget and will result in a 1.89% tax levy increase, which is within the district’s tax levy limit.
Voters also approved the following propositions;
Bus Purchase: two 66-passenger diesel buses and one passenger vehicle, by a vote of 155 (yes) to 59 (no).
Library Levy: approval of a $49,342 levy to support the Arkport Public Library’s 2026-27 budget, by a vote of 139 (yes) to 72 (no).
One trustee to the Arkport Public Library Board, Rebecca Dennis.

Board of Education Results
One candidate ran uncontested to fill one open seat on the Board of Education. The vote total is as follows:
Timothy Bailey – 90
Bailey will fill a five-year term beginning on July 1, 2026.
